Refinery Stocks in India

Discover India's popular refinery stocks, their market positions, and investment potential as energy demand and industrialisation continue to grow.
Refinery Stocks in India
3 min
18-April-2025
India's refinery sector plays a pivotal role in the country's energy infrastructure. With growing industrialisation and rising energy demands, refineries are crucial in processing crude oil into essential products like petrol, diesel, and aviation fuel. As India works towards energy security and diversifying its energy sources, the refining industry remains a significant contributor to economic growth. This article offers a comprehensive overview of refinery stocks, highlighting popular companies, their market positions, and factors to consider before investing in this vital sector.

Popular refinery stocks

The Indian refining sector features several prominent players, each contributing substantially to the nation's fuel production and energy security. These companies, ranging from large integrated corporations to smaller regional players, have shown resilience and adaptability in a competitive and ever-evolving market. As energy consumption rises, refinery stocks present attractive investment opportunities for individuals seeking exposure to the sector's potential. In this article, we explore some of the leading refinery stocks in India, including their market capitalisation, business models, and growth prospects.

List of refinery stocks in India

Here is a comprehensive list of refinery stocks in India, sorted by market capitalisation. These companies are major players in the sector, contributing to India's refining capacity. The table below provides the latest market capitalisation figures, which can fluctuate depending on stock market performance, crude oil prices, and company performance. Investors looking to diversify into the energy sector should consider these key refinery companies.

Company NameMarket Capitalisation (Rs. Crore)
Reliance Industries Ltd16,73,278
Indian Oil Corporation Ltd1,73,098
Bharat Petroleum Corporation Ltd1,11,955
Hindustan Petroleum Corporation Ltd74,367
Mangalore Refinery and Petrochemicals Ltd21,569
Chennai Petroleum Corporation Ltd7,797
Gandhar Oil Refinery (India) Ltd1,671


What are refinery stocks?

Refinery stocks represent shares in companies involved in the refining of crude oil into usable products like gasoline, diesel, kerosene, and other petrochemicals. These stocks are highly correlated with global oil prices, as the refining margins (the difference between crude oil costs and the price of refined products) can significantly impact profitability. Investors in refinery stocks are essentially betting on the future demand for petroleum products and the company's ability to manage refining operations efficiently. With India’s growing energy needs, investing in refinery stocks can offer long-term gains.

Features of refinery stocks

  • Refinery stocks are highly sensitive to fluctuations in global crude oil prices.
  • They tend to perform in cycles, benefiting from periods of high oil demand and refining capacity utilization.
  • Many refining companies have diversified their operations into petrochemicals, which helps expand revenue streams.
  • Investors must consider geopolitical risks, regulatory changes, and the global economic environment, as these can affect the profitability of refinery stocks.
  • Environmental regulations and compliance costs can also impact the operations and costs of refining companies.

Types of refinery stocks

  • Integrated refinery stocks: These belong to companies managing the entire oil supply chain, from exploration to production and refining, like Reliance Industries Ltd and Indian Oil Corporation.
  • Non-integrated refinery stocks: These focus purely on refining, relying on external sources for crude oil. They generate revenue primarily from refining operations.
  • Integrated companies benefit from diversified business models, while non-integrated ones are more exposed to refining margins and crude price fluctuations.
  • When choosing refinery stocks, consider the company’s scale, business model, and diversification.

How to invest in refinery stocks in India?

  • Open a Demat account and trading account with a registered stockbroker.
  • Once the accounts are set up, research refinery stocks, including their financial health and market performance.
  • Consider the impact of crude oil price trends, energy policies, and the refining company’s financial track record.
  • You can place buy or sell orders through your stockbroker's platform once you’ve chosen stocks to invest in.
  • In-depth research will help ensure your investments align with your financial objectives and risk tolerance.

Benefits of refinery stocks in India

  • Refinery stocks provide stable returns due to their critical role in energy production and the high demand for petroleum products.
  • Many refining companies also engage in petrochemical production, diversifying their revenue sources.
  • These stocks are ideal for long-term investors seeking exposure to the growing energy sector in India.
  • Refining companies in India benefit from the country’s large petroleum consumption base, which supports demand for their products.
  • Many refinery stocks offer dividends, making them attractive to income-seeking investors.

Risks of investing in refinery stocks

  • Fluctuations in crude oil prices can directly affect refining margins, leading to volatility in profitability.
  • Significant increases in crude prices can shrink refining margins, reducing company profits.
  • Regulatory risks, including environmental compliance costs, can affect refinery operations and profitability.
  • Geopolitical instability and global economic downturns can disrupt refinery operations and impact stock prices.
  • The cyclical nature of the oil market means refinery stocks can face periods of volatility, especially during economic recessions or oil demand dips.

Factors to consider before investing in refinery stocks

  • Evaluate a company’s refining capacity, market share, and potential for growth.
  • Assess the company’s financial health, including profitability, debt levels, and cash flow, to understand its stability.
  • Monitor global oil price trends, government policies on fuel pricing, and environmental regulations, as these can influence profitability.
  • Look at the company’s diversification strategy, such as expansion into petrochemicals or renewable energy, which can provide additional revenue streams.
  • A comprehensive assessment of these factors will help in making informed investment decisions.

Who should invest in refinery stocks in India?

  • Refinery stocks are suited for investors with moderate to high risk tolerance.
  • These stocks are ideal for long-term investors who want exposure to the energy sector and are willing to manage market volatility.
  • Investors confident in India's growing energy demands and government infrastructure investments may find refinery stocks appealing.
  • These stocks are not ideal for conservative investors seeking low-risk, stable returns, as refinery stocks can experience market fluctuations tied to global oil price volatility.
  • Consider your risk appetite before investing in refinery stocks.

Conclusion

Refinery stocks represent an important investment opportunity for those looking to capitalise on India’s growing energy sector. Companies like Reliance Industries, Indian Oil Corporation, and Bharat Petroleum Corporation are significant players with robust market positions. However, potential investors should carefully evaluate the risks, including global oil price volatility and regulatory changes. By considering factors such as the company’s financial health, refining capacity, and market trends, investors can make informed decisions. With the right approach, refinery stocks can provide both growth and income opportunities in India’s energy sector.

Frequently asked questions

Are refinery stocks a good investment?
Refinery stocks can be a good investment for those looking to gain exposure to the energy sector. These stocks offer stability due to the high demand for refined products and their essential role in energy production. However, they are sensitive to fluctuations in crude oil prices, so potential investors should consider market volatility and geopolitical risks. Long-term investors seeking stable returns may find refinery stocks appealing.

What factors should I consider when choosing refinery stocks?
When choosing refinery stocks, consider factors like a company's refining capacity, market share, and growth potential. Review its financial health, including profitability, debt levels, and cash flow, to ensure stability. Also, evaluate external elements such as crude oil price trends, government regulations, and environmental policies. Additionally, consider diversification strategies and whether the company is expanding into other sectors like petrochemicals or renewable energy to enhance long-term growth prospects.

Is it necessary to invest directly in refinery stocks?
It’s not necessary to invest directly in refinery stocks if you prefer indirect exposure to the sector. You can gain exposure by investing in exchange-traded funds (ETFs) or mutual funds that focus on the energy or oil refining sector. These investment vehicles offer diversification by holding shares in multiple refinery companies, reducing individual stock risk. Direct investment in refinery stocks, however, may offer higher returns but comes with higher risk.

Are there any small-cap oil refinery stocks in India?
Yes, there are small-cap oil refinery stocks in India. These companies tend to have smaller market capitalisation but offer potential for higher growth. While they carry more risk due to their smaller size and limited resources, they may outperform larger companies in certain market conditions. Investors interested in small-cap refinery stocks should thoroughly research the company’s financial health, market outlook, and growth potential to assess the associated risks and rewards.

Show More Show Less

Bajaj Finserv App for all your financial needs and goals

Trusted by 50 million+ customers in India, Bajaj Finserv App is a one-stop solution for all your financial needs and goals.

You can use the Bajaj Finserv App to:

Apply for loans online, such as Instant Personal Loan, Home Loan, Business Loan, Gold Loan, and more.

Explore and apply for co-branded credit cards online.

Invest in fixed deposits and mutual funds on the app.

Choose from multiple insurance for your health, motor and even pocket insurance, from various insurance providers.

Pay and manage your bills and recharges using the BBPS platform. Use Bajaj Pay and Bajaj Wallet for quick and simple money transfers and transactions.

Apply for Insta EMI Card and get a pre-approved limit on the app. Explore over 1 million products on the app that can be purchased from a partner store on Easy EMIs.

Shop from over 100+ brand partners that offer a diverse range of products and services.

Use specialised tools like EMI calculators, SIP Calculators

Check your credit score, download loan statements, and even get quick customer support—all on the app.

Download the Bajaj Finserv App today and experience the convenience of managing your finances on one app.

Do more with the Bajaj Finserv App!

UPI, Wallet, Loans, Investments, Cards, Shopping and more

Standard Disclaimer

Investments in the securities market are subject to market risk, read all related documents carefully before investing.

Research Disclaimer

Broking services offered by Bajaj Financial Securities Limited (BFSL) | Registered Office: Bajaj Auto Limited Complex , Mumbai –Pune Road Akurdi Pune 411035 | Corporate Office: Bajaj Financial Securities Ltd,1st Floor, Mantri IT Park, Tower B, Unit No 9 & 10, Viman Nagar, Pune, Maharashtra 411014| CIN: U67120PN2010PLC136026| SEBI Registration No.: INZ000218931 | BSE Cash/F&O (Member ID: 6706) | DP registration No : IN-DP-418-2019 | CDSL DP No.: 12088600 | NSDL DP No. IN304300 | AMFI Registration No.: ARN – 163403|

Research Services are offered by Bajaj Financial Securities Limited (BFSL) as Research Analyst under SEBI Regn: INH000010043. Kindly refer to www.bajajfinservsecurities.in for detailed disclaimer and risk factors

This content is for educational purpose only.

Details of Compliance Officer: Ms. Kanti Pal (For Broking/DP/Research)|Email: compliance_sec@bajajfinserv.in/Compliance_dp@bajajfinserv.in |Contact No.: 020-4857 4486 |

Investment in the securities involves risks, investor should consult his own advisors/consultant to determine the merits and risks of investment.